html {
    scroll-behavior: smooth;
}

.section_container .intro_content .subcribes {
    position: relative !important;
    display: block;
}

.section_container .intro_content .subcribes .btn_submit {
    position: relative !important;
    right: unset;
    left: unset;
    top: unset;
}

.feature-image {
    width: 100%;
    max-height: 550px;
    object-fit: scale-down;
}

.blog_content img {
    width: 100%;
    max-height: 450px;
    object-fit: scale-down;
}

@media (min-width:991px) {
    .menu > .nav-item > .main-menu-login {
        padding-right: 40px !important;
    }
}
